Undersized Return Air Pathways
Many properties in Bellbrook, especially in older sections near Main Street and West Franklin Street, feature return air grilles that no longer match the cooling capacity of upgraded systems. This leads to restricted airflow and uneven cooling, creating pressure imbalances that reduce system efficiency.
Local technicians correct inadequate return air with additional grille installations, duct resizing, and airflow balancing, preventing long-lasting comfort issues.
Basement Humidity and Condensation
The neighborhood's mature landscaping and sloped lots add curb appeal, but they often cause water drainage toward foundation walls. Poor grading around basement window wells can lead to elevated indoor humidity and condensation on ductwork.
Professionals manage these spaces with dehumidifier integration, sealed duct connections, and drainage improvements, adapted to existing foundation conditions.
Aging Air Handler Components
Years of seasonal cycling have left many Bellbrook air handlers struggling to maintain consistent temperature control. Worn blower motors, dirty coils, and failing capacitors reduce airflow and strain compressor operation.
Trusted HVAC pros maintain these spaces through motor lubrication, coil cleaning, and capacitor replacement, enhancing cooling performance and equipment longevity.

Limited Outdoor Unit Clearance
Fenced yards and landscaping features are common in Bellbrook, making condenser placement and airflow harder. Shrubs, decorative stones, and privacy fences can block airflow to outdoor units and trap heat around coils.
Local pros use clearance assessments and strategic trimming, prioritizing proper ventilation and coil access to deliver professional heating repair that fits every property.

AC Maintenance Service in Bellbrook, OH
- Bi-Annual System Inspections and Tune-Ups: Spring and fall maintenance visits include filter changes, coil cleaning, refrigerant checks, electrical testing, and airflow verification to keep systems running efficiently through every season.
- Condensate Pump Testing and Cleaning: Homes with basement air handlers rely on condensate pumps to remove moisture, so technicians test pump operation, clear debris, and verify proper drainage to prevent overflow and water damage.
- Belt and Pulley Inspection on Older Blowers: Belt-driven blower assemblies in older furnaces and air handlers require periodic tension adjustments, alignment checks, and belt replacement to maintain quiet, reliable airflow.
- Outdoor Unit Leveling and Pad Inspection: Settling soil and frost heave can tilt condenser units, causing vibration, refrigerant line stress, and compressor wear, which technicians correct by releveling pads and stabilizing unit placement.
- Duct Register Cleaning and Airflow Balancing: Dust buildup in floor and wall registers reduces airflow to individual rooms, so crews clean registers, adjust dampers, and balance system output to ensure even cooling throughout the home, similar to expert furnace repair practices applied across Dayton.
Routine maintenance prevents breakdowns, lowers energy bills, and keeps indoor air fresh and comfortable.
